HSM 15 Hut at Cape Royds, Ross Island, built in February 1908 by the British Antarctic Expedition.
HSM 16 Hut at Cape Evans, Ross Island, built in January 1911 by the British Antarctic Expedition.
HSM 17 Cross on Wind Vane Hill, Cape Evans, Ross Island, erected by the Ross Sea Party in memory of three members of the party who died in the vicinity in 1916.

(a) In General.—Whoever violates subsection (a)(1), (b), (c), or (d) of section 26 of the Animal Welfare Act shall be fined under this title, imprisoned for not more than 5 years, or both, for each violation.
